Name:Extractive Workings on Knighton Heath, Hennock

Summary

A number of earthwork pits and pond-like features, as well as possible earthwork mounds, two shafts and a structure are depicted on historic maps from the late 19th century onwards, on Knighton Heath, Hennock. Earthworks of some of these features are also visible on aerial photographs taken from 1946. They are interpreted as evidence of extractive workings for possible clay dating from the late 19th century up until the first half of the 20th century. The features have been almost completely subsumed by Chudleigh Knighton Clay Works.

Hegarty, C., Knight, S. and Sims, R., 2018-2019, The South Devon Coast to Dartmoor Aerial Investigation and Mapping Survey. Area 1, Haldon Ridge to Dart Valley (AI&M) (Interpretation). SDV361305.

Sub-oval and irregularly shaped pits, between 15m to 50m long, are visible as earthworks on aerial photographs taken from 1946 onwards, on Knighton Heath, Hennock. The earthworks are located in proximity to, and are likely associated with, a concentration of pond-like features shown in this location on the First Edition Ordnance Survey Map of the late 19th century. An additional number of these feature, as well as earthworks of pits and possible mounds, two ‘Shafts’ and a structure are also depicted on the Fourth Edition Ordnance Survey map of the 1930’s. The earthworks and features shown on these historic maps are interpreted as evidence of extractive workings dating from the late 19th century and which continued in use during the first half of the 20th century. Two monument records of clay pits (MDV21178 and MDV9990) in this location may give some indication as to the function of these features. Aerial imagery taken between 1999-2000 show that much of this area has been subsumed by Chudleigh Knighton Clay Works, although some earthworks are visible on digital images derived from lidar data captured between 1998 and 2017 to the far northwest . Only those features not shown on historic maps have been transcribed during this survey, although the remaining features have been included within the general monument polygon based on these maps.
